WebBraised Chicken Feet. Braised Chicken Feet, also known as Phoenix Claws, is a popular Hong Kong food. It’s a dish made of deep-fried chicken feet braised with oyster sauce, soy sauce, sake, pepper, garlic, black bean sauce, and sesame oil. The feet are then steamed until the cartilage, skin and meat are softened to a melt-in-the-mouth texture.
